Understanding the 99 Names of Allah & Their Connection to the Prophet
Exploring the magnificent 99 Names of Allah, also known as Asma ul-Husna, offers a enriching journey into the nature of God. These names aren't simply titles ; they are reflections of His attributes, providing understandings into His limitless power and mercy. A key aspect of comprehending these names lies in recognizing their direct connection to the Prophet Muhammad (peace be upon him). Many of the Asma ul-Husna are embodied in his conduct , demonstrating how Allah's attributes are mirrored through his actions and teachings. For instance, his steadfast justice reflects As-`Adl (The Just), and his overflowing compassion showcases Ar-Rahman (The Most Compassionate). Studying these names alongside the Prophet's tradition helps believers internalize their significance and incorporate them into their own spiritual lives.
